21Shares, in collaboration with FUSE, has released a survey report addressing the educational gap in digital assets among financial advisors. The report, which surveyed over 350 U.S. financial advisors, reveals that 84% believe current crypto education materials are severely lacking. Advisors already involved in crypto assets plan to increase their allocation from 3.8% to 6.4% over the next two years, with 65% viewing crypto as a "core" part of their portfolios. The report also notes a strong focus on Bitcoin and Ethereum single-asset strategies, with less interest in altcoins and diversified portfolios.
